For anyone who missed the awards last night I will include the list of awards and winners below. 


 NTA AWARD                                WINNER                                  MY VOTE

Entertainment Show                      I'm a Celebrity                         I'm a Celebrity
Drama Performance                      Sheridan Smith                     Dame Maggie Smith
Skills Challenge Show              Great British Bake Off                Come Dine With Me
Entertainment Presenter                    Ant & Dec                             Ant & Dec
Newcomer                                        Maddy Hill                         Cameron Moore  
Daytime                                          This Morning                          The Chase
Comedy                                       Mrs Browns Boys             The Big Bang Theory
Serial Drama Performance              Danny Dyer                         Nikki Sanderson
TV Judge                                       David Walliams                      Simon Cowell
Multichannel                                  Celebrity Juice                        Celebrity Juice
Chat Show Host                                 Alan Carr                               Alan Carr 
Factual                                            Gogglebox                      For The Love Of Dogs
Drama                                           Downtown Abbey                          Cilla 
Serial Drama                                    Eastenders                             Eastenders
Talent Show                                       XFactor                          Britains Got Talent

Also a Special Recognition Award was given to David Tennant.
